Beautiful, quiet spot. Clean toilets. Unfortunately there are quite a lot of sandflies, so be prepared. Definitely don’t miss a night walk on the Carew Falls Track — in good conditions you can see lots of glowworms along the way. Truly beautiful and magical.
We first tried Iveagh Beach quite late, around 11 pm. It was completely full. So we drove the half hour further to here. Yes, the gravel road here isn't great, with a slight corrugation and a few potholes, but it's manageable. The campsite was completely empty. It was a bit eerie because it was so secluded and quiet, but everything was fine in the morning. Nice spot and good toilets.
Nice and quiet spot. Missing flat area but it's not bad. Just one other campervan. Very nice toilets.

It was such a nice campsite (despite how sloping it was and the unsealed road on the way in). We arrived during the day and were the only ones here. The water is so close by and the toilets look new and were clean (but are long drops and there’s no running water)
